What this episode covers
Buffalo Bills squeak past Cleveland Browns in a blunder-filled matchup that raises questions about Super Bowl ambitions. Can Josh Allen and James Cook carry an offense plagued by drops, injuries, and predictable playcalling? With 117 rushing yards and two touchdowns, Cook proves indispensable, but Buffalo’s receiving corps and defensive game plan leave fans frustrated. Jeremy White, Joe Marino, and Jerry Ostroski break down Myles Garrett’s impact, the flip-flopping linebacker rotation, and glaring third-down defense issues. The conversation spotlights the coaching staff’s conservative approach, the implications of Larry Ogunjobi’s absence, and how the offensive line handled Cleveland’s pass rush. As playoff positioning heats up, the crew debates whether the Bills are built for January success—and what needs to change before facing the Philadelphia Eagles.
